NCT Number: NCT00624338
This study is to evaluate the efficacy and safety of atacicept compared to placebo in preventing new flares in subjects with systemic lupus erythematosus (SLE) and to confirm the optimal dose of atacicept for treatment of subjects with SLE and gain information on the effect of atacicept on markers specific to its mechanism of action (MoA) and their correlation to disease activity/progression. Study medication will be administered through subcutaneous (under the skin) injections, beginning with twice weekly injections for the first 4 weeks, followed by once weekly doses for 48 weeks. Following the last treatment, a safety follow-up period of 24 weeks will be conducted.

Time frame: From screening up to Week 52
A flare was defined as having an adjudicated BILAG A or B score in any of the 8 organ systems during treatment, or imputed for participants who had premature treatment discontinuation. Discontinuations due to sponsor termination of the atacicept 150 mg group were not imputed as flares in this analysis. The BILAG disease activity index evaluates systemic lupus erythematosus (SLE) activity in 8 organ systems, using a separate alphabetic score (A to E) assigned to each organ system defined as follows. BILAG A: Disease sufficiently active requiring disease-modifying treatment (prednisone greater than 20 mg daily or immunosuppressants); BILAG B: Disease less active than in "A", mild reversible problems requiring only symptomatic therapy such as antimalarials, non-steroidal anti-inflammatory drugs (NSAIDs), or prednisone less than 20 mg day; BILAG C: Stable mild disease; BILAG D: System previously affected but now inactive; BILAG E: System never involved.
